    I think this is a question for Ossie: I’m looking for some good options for crackers to use at lunch and snacks. I already use Rye Crispbreads but I would like some variety. I am wondering if Dr Kracker’s Pumpkin Seed Cheddar Flatbread would be a good choice for a whole grain cracker. In fact, they have several products that I would use if I knew they would be a good choice for me on the TDC program. Their products are organic and here is the ingredient list for the pumpkin Seed Cheddar Flatbread: INGREDIENTS: ORGANIC WHOLE WHEAT FLOUR, ORGANIC WHEAT FLOUR, ORGANIC CHEDDAR CHEESE (PASTEURIZED CULTURED MILK, SALT AND ENZYMES), ORGANIC PUMPKIN SEEDS, ORGANIC OATS, ORGANIC FLAXSEEDS, ORGANIC SUNFLOWER SEEDS, ORGANIC EXTRA VIRGIN OLIVE OIL, ORGANIC CANOLA OIL, SEA SALT, FILTERED WATER, ORGANIC SESAME SEEDS, YEAST, ROSEMARY EXTRACT. Other stats:Calories: 100, Calories from Fat: 40, Total Fat 4g, Saturated Fat 1.5g,Trans Fat 0g, Cholesterol < 5mg, Sodium 180mg, Total Carbohydrate 11g, Dietary Fiber 4g, Sugars 0g, Protein 5g
    If this would be a good choice, what would it count as far as exchanges? Thanks in advance!

    #24671

    Hi, Nettums. Those are great! One serving is equal to about 1/2 carb, 1/2 protein, and 1/2 fat exchange.
